         <title>Refrigerating Foods</title>
         <author>agostabrooke</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/agostabrooke/u7d5yx8mwzvj/wish/139323269</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<ol><li>Most foods kept in the refrigerator should be packaged in airtight wraps or containers&nbsp;</li><li>Store the freshest foods in the back of the refrigerator while the oldest are in the front so they can be used first&nbsp;</li><li>Do not overstock the fridge, cool air needs to be able to circulate through all the foods. Clean the refrigerator when needed.</li><li>Meats, dairy products and some fruits and vegetables need to be refrigerated to keep them fresh</li><li>Store meat, poultry, fish and alternates in the coldest part of the refrigerator&nbsp;</li><li>When stored in the fridge, fish must be tightly wrapped in foil or plastic wrap otherwise the odor of the fish will harm other foods stored in the fridge</li><li>Fruits and vegetables should not be washed before storing them in the crisper section of the fridge</li><li>Oils and fats should be refrigerated once opened. When refrigerated cooking oils then should be used within a few weeks</li></ol>]]></description>

         <title>Freezing Foods</title>
         <author>schillingkinzey</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/agostabrooke/u7d5yx8mwzvj/wish/139324309</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<ol><li>Tightly wrap food in heavy duty freezer wrap or aluminum foil or place them in airtight freezer containers&nbsp;</li><li>Label and date all frozen foods so you can easily identify them and avoid storing them too long&nbsp;</li><li>To maintain food quality, keep freezer temperatures at 0 degrees fahrenheit or below and keep frozen foods frozen until ready to prepare or serve them</li><li>Maintain dry storage room temperature between 50 degrees F and 70 degrees F</li></ol><div><br></div>]]></description>

         <title>Storing Pantry Items</title>
         <author>schillingkinzey</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/agostabrooke/u7d5yx8mwzvj/wish/139325296</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<ol><li>Place foods such as flour, cereals, pasta, dried beans, and peas in tightly sealed containers in cool, dry places&nbsp;</li><li>Keep onions and potatoes in net bags or other containers that allow air to circulate&nbsp;</li><li>Store breads and rolls on shelves for a few days, otherwise for longer storage freeze them to prevent mold growth</li><li>Store fruits and vegetables in cans and jars on shelves, however refrigerate these products after opening&nbsp;</li></ol>]]></description>

         <title>When Storing All Foods</title>
         <author>schillingkinzey</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/agostabrooke/u7d5yx8mwzvj/wish/139325648</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<ol><li>Store items 6 to 8 inches off the floor so that all areas on the floor can be cleaned&nbsp;</li><li>Label all foods and dates, especially when you open the food&nbsp;</li><li>Store leftovers within two hours after the time they were served&nbsp;</li><li>Meat should be used within 3-4 days while poultry and fresh fish within 1-2 days&nbsp;</li></ol><div><br></div>]]></description>
